The Canon 5D Mark IV has established itself as a benchmark in the world of digital photography since its launch in 2016. This fullframe DSLR camera has become a favorite among professionals for its impressive image quality, robust build, and versatile performance. In the years since its release, the innovation behind its operating system has not only enhanced its capabilities but also paved the way for future developments in Canon’s digital imaging technology.
Operating System Development
At the heart of the 5D Mark IV lies a sophisticated operating system designed to facilitate a seamless experience for photographers. The camera runs on Canon’s Digic 6+ processor, which enables faster processing times, improved autofocus performance, and superior image quality, especially in lowlight conditions. This processor allows the camera to perform rapid calculations and manage the significant amount of data generated by highresolution images.
Canon has consistently updated the firmware for the 5D Mark IV, offering enhancements and fixes that improve the overall functionality of the camera. These firmware updates often include new features, improved autofocus algorithms, and better compatibility with lenses and accessories, ensuring that users continue to get the most from their equipment. This focus on continuous improvement highlights Canon’s commitment to innovation and customer satisfaction.
Hotspots in Canon 5D Mark IV Features
When discussing hotspots in the Canon 5D Mark IV, several standout features come to mind:
1. Dual Pixel AF Technology: One of the significant advancements is the implementation of Dual Pixel autofocus, which provides fast and accurate focusing. This technology allows for smooth focus transitions during video recording and enhances performance in live view mode, making the 5D Mark IV a favorite for videographers and photographers alike.
2. 4K Video Capability: Another hotspot is the camera’s ability to record in 4K resolution, appealing to content creators looking to capture highdefinition video. Though the 4K recording does have a crop factor, this feature opens up new creative possibilities for filmmakers and offers a level of detail that was previously unavailable in consumerlevel cameras.
3. WiFi and GPS Connectivity: The integration of builtin WiFi and GPS is crucial for photographers who need to share their work quickly. With WiFi connectivity, users can transfer images wirelessly to their smartphones, use remote shooting capabilities, and even geotag their photos, enhancing their workflow significantly.
4. Robust Build and Weather Sealing: The durability of the 5D Mark IV continues to be one of its highlights. With a magnesium alloy body and extensive weather sealing, this camera is built to withstand the rigors of various environments, allowing photographers to explore different shooting conditions without worrying about equipment failure.
5. Improved LowLight Performance: Canon has made strides in noise reduction and dynamic range with the 5D Mark IV. The camera offers an ISO range of 10032,000 (expandable to 50102,400), which allows for exceptional lowlight performance, making it ideal for shooting events in dimly lit venues.
